Air Pollution

One of the most significant environmental concerns in sheet metal box welding is air pollution. Welding processes, such as arc welding and gas welding, generate fumes and particulate matter that can be harmful to both human health and the environment. These fumes often contain toxic metals, such as lead, cadmium, and chromium, as well as harmful gases like nitrogen oxides and ozone.

When inhaled, these pollutants can cause respiratory problems, lung damage, and even cancer. Moreover, they can contribute to the formation of smog and acid rain, which have far-reaching environmental consequences. As a responsible supplier, we are committed to reducing air pollution by implementing proper ventilation systems in our welding areas. These systems capture and filter the fumes, preventing them from being released into the atmosphere. Additionally, we use welding techniques and materials that produce fewer fumes, such as low-fume electrodes and shielding gases.

Energy Consumption

Sheet metal box welding is an energy-intensive process. The equipment used, such as welding machines, ovens, and compressors, requires a significant amount of electricity to operate. This high energy consumption not only contributes to greenhouse gas emissions but also increases our operating costs.

To address this issue, we are constantly looking for ways to improve the energy efficiency of our welding processes. We invest in modern, energy-efficient equipment that consumes less power while maintaining high performance. For example, we use inverter-based welding machines, which are more energy-efficient than traditional transformer-based machines. We also optimize our production schedules to minimize idle time and reduce energy waste.

Waste Generation

Another environmental impact of sheet metal box welding is waste generation. During the welding process, there is often excess metal, slag, and other waste materials that need to be disposed of properly. If not managed correctly, these waste materials can end up in landfills, where they can take up valuable space and potentially leach harmful chemicals into the soil and groundwater.

To reduce waste generation, we implement a comprehensive waste management system. We recycle as much of the scrap metal as possible, sending it back to the suppliers for reuse. We also separate and properly dispose of other waste materials, such as slag and used welding electrodes, in accordance with environmental regulations. By reducing waste generation and promoting recycling, we not only minimize our environmental impact but also save on disposal costs.

Noise Pollution

Welding operations can generate significant noise levels, which can be a nuisance to workers and nearby residents. Prolonged exposure to high noise levels can cause hearing loss and other health problems. As a supplier, we are aware of the importance of protecting the health and well-being of our workers and the surrounding community.

To reduce noise pollution, we use noise-reducing equipment and techniques. For example, we install soundproof enclosures around our welding machines to contain the noise. We also provide our workers with appropriate hearing protection devices, such as earplugs and earmuffs. By taking these measures, we ensure that our welding operations comply with noise regulations and minimize the impact on the environment and human health.

Positive Environmental Impacts

While sheet metal box welding has its share of environmental challenges, it also has some positive environmental impacts. For example, sheet metal is a highly recyclable material. At the end of its life cycle, sheet metal boxes can be easily recycled and reused to make new products. This reduces the demand for virgin materials and conserves natural resources.

In addition, sheet metal box welding can contribute to the development of more sustainable products. For example, sheet metal boxes are often used in the manufacturing of renewable energy systems, such as solar panels and wind turbines. By providing high-quality sheet metal boxes, we support the growth of the renewable energy industry and help to reduce our dependence on fossil fuels.

Solutions and Future Outlook

To further reduce the environmental impacts of sheet metal box welding, we are exploring several solutions. One approach is to adopt more sustainable welding technologies, such as laser welding and friction stir welding. These technologies produce fewer fumes and consume less energy compared to traditional welding methods.

We are also investing in research and development to find new ways to improve the environmental performance of our products and processes. For example, we are exploring the use of environmentally friendly coatings and finishes that can reduce the corrosion of sheet metal boxes and extend their lifespan.
